Summary

This study introduces signal dissection by correlation maximization (SDCM), an unsupervised learning method to uncover gene interaction networks from high-dimensional gene expression data. SDCM identifies novel survival-predictive signatures in diffuse large B-cell lymphoma, outperforming existing methods.
